Output e56facbcf59dbeef3875e77fb84c6b419b53b03bcd233e6d32a2473578f19e7b:0

value
2944431893
script pubkey
OP_0 OP_PUSHBYTES_20 78289a6be3240e071949c1a6692d0e2f5265e5a5
address
tb1q0q5f56lrys8qwx2fcxnxjtgw9afxted9yxjjg5
transaction
e56facbcf59dbeef3875e77fb84c6b419b53b03bcd233e6d32a2473578f19e7b